New York City International Film Festival – March 5th- March 9th 2018

                   Now in its ninth year, the New York City International Film Festival will showcase filmmakers from around the world in three distinctive New York venues: The Directors Guild of America, The Dolby Theater & Screening Room and The Producers Club. Over five days, the NYCIFF will screen 19 short films including one animation, and 13 feature length films.

                            This year’s festival will kick off Monday, March 5th with a red-carpet gala followed by the screening of selected feature, The Girl Who Invented Kissing. Audiences are then invited to a Q&A with the stars and filmmakers.

This will be followed by actor and director Steve Stanulis presenting the world premiere of his documentary project, Wasted Talent, following embattled Bronx Tale star Lillo Brancatoalso on March 5th.

 

The NYCIFF will close with a VIP reception and special screening of Keely Shaye Smith and Pierce Brosnan’s Poisoning Paradise, followed by a Q&A with the creators and awards reception honoring actress Natali Yura, with the Rising Star Award, and philanthropist, Jean Shafiroff, with the Philanthropic Award for Art, Culture & Film.

Tickets sales from NYCIFF will benefit the New York International Film Festival’s Foundation for the Arts, established to provide scholarships and opportunities to aspiring filmmakers, directors and performers around the world. The event was founded by Robert Rizzo. Two awards will be given. Natali Yura will receive the Rising Star Award and Jean Shafiroff will receive the Philanthropic Award for Art, Culture & Film.
